across the country it is common for termites to be referred to as ‘white ants’. These are insect pests that can cause extensive damage to structures and houses in Milsons Point Sydney annually, making termite treatment so important.
You will find several kinds of termite situations therefore the best treatments also vary. When you call in the pros, they are going to apply one of two general termite removal strategies. This may include chemical treatments that form a barrier between the termites and the building you wish to protect. Or perhaps, the extermination of the termite colony with baiting techniques.
Chemical treatments are a more typical treatment to kill white ants in Milsons Point homes. Remember, intercepting and baiting to exterminate the colony also has some distinct advantages that cannot be forgotten.

The chemicals are easily detected by termites / white ants, making them great for providing protection on treated places. However, if the treated areas are not completely covered, or if they are later compromised, termites can sense these breaks and again access the house.
Bifenthrin has a residual life of up to 5 years and is a widely used chemical repellent on the market today.
Non repellents are chemicals that termites cannot detect. Since they then do not avoid them, they will go through the residue and die. In addition, individual termites can also pass these chemicals to other members of the colony, generating a compounding and efficient result.
Because termites can’t tell the difference between treated places to non-treated places, the possibility for termite ingress via untreated gaps is much lower.
The most common used non repellent chemical is Fipronil which has a residual life expectancy of as much as 8 years.
Above Ground Systems are often used to erradicate termites from your home, by locating bait stations directly on termite paths to encourage the white ants to feed on the bait as opposed to the timber. In addition, when worker termites return to the colony, they unknowingly transfer the bait to other members of the colony, therefore causing a flow on result.
The entire nest may be exterminated in this way, regardless of if the position of the colony is known or not. The area should continue to be regularly monitored so if required, stations can be rebaited or moved, or more can be added, depending on the observed white ant activity.
In Ground Systems are used in a similar manner, however they are often positioned around properties where there is currently no obvious activity, to help in early detection of termites. These systems are especially helpful when the layout of a house will make it hard to have adequate perimeter barriers, since it is then possible to intercept termites before they breach the perimeter.
